Recognizing Fraudulent Brokers: Warning Signs & Alerting Indicators
Protecting your assets starts with being able to identify a fake broker. Be extremely cautious of unexpected offers promising certain profits; this is a major red warning. Be wary of brokers who pressure you to invest money quickly, avoid sharing clear details about charges, or operate solely via email without a official online presence. Always verify a broker's license with relevant financial authorities before committing any deposit. Doubt brokers who claim to be affiliated with well-known companies without proper proof.

{Broker Review Scam: How to Recognize Fake Reviews
Safeguarding yourself from dishonest broker assessments is crucial in today's challenging financial landscape. Numerous scammers are producing fake endorsements to promote unreliable brokers. Look for unusually positive language, absence of specific details about brokerage experiences, and a consistent theme across multiple platforms . Evaluate if the reviewer has a genuine profile and check the time of the review ; very new ones, especially with unusually glowing descriptions, should raise suspicion. In conclusion, always cross-reference information from multiple sources before reaching any judgments .
